How to Find Us
We are a 20-minute tube ride from Central London and easily accessible by bus and car.
You can get to us directly on the District, Piccadilly, Circle and Hammersmith & City lines to Hammersmith (2 minutes walk from the theatre). The last tube home is after 11.45pm - and that gives you plenty of time to make changes on the underground. There is step-free access from all of the above stations.
Visit Transport for London here
Lots of buses go to and through Hammersmith. We're just two minutes from Hammersmith Broadway Bus Station.
